Как удалить элемент из выпадающего списка с помощью jquery?

Пользователь

от nicolette.stoltenberg , в категории: JavaScript , 2 года назад

Как удалить элемент из выпадающего списка с помощью jquery?

Facebook Vk Ok Twitter LinkedIn Telegram Whatsapp

2 ответа

Пользователь

от elda , 2 года назад

@nicolette.stoltenberg 

Чтобы удалить элемент из выпадающего списка с помощью jQuery, вам нужно использовать метод .remove().


Например, если у вас есть выпадающий список с идентификатором myDropdown и вы хотите удалить первый элемент списка, вы можете использовать следующий код:

1
$("#myDropdown option:first").remove();


Здесь мы используем селектор #myDropdown для выбора выпадающего списка по его идентификатору, а затем селектор option:first для выбора первого элемента списка. Метод .remove() удаляет этот элемент из списка.


Если вы хотите удалить определенный элемент списка, вы можете использовать селектор :eq() и указать индекс элемента, который вы хотите удалить. Например, чтобы удалить второй элемент списка, вы можете использовать следующий код:

1
$("#myDropdown option:eq(1)").remove();


Здесь мы используем селектор option:eq(1) для выбора второго элемента списка (индекс элемента начинается с 0).

Пользователь

от lamar , 7 месяцев назад

@nicolette.stoltenberg 

Добавлю, что можно использовать другие селекторы для выбора элемента, который нужно удалить из выпадающего списка с помощью jQuery. Например, вы можете выбрать элемент по его значению или тексту.


Например, чтобы удалить элемент по его значению, можно использовать следующий код:

1
$("#myDropdown option[value='значение']").remove();


Или чтобы удалить элемент по его тексту, можно использовать:

1
$("#myDropdown option:contains('текст')").remove();


Таким образом, вы можете выбрать и удалить элемент из выпадающего списка с помощью jQuery, используя различные селекторы в зависимости от ваших потребностей.